I got my test fish racing scene hooked up to the normal tank scene. The game now holds onto your save data in memory and loads it on return (this works for non-signed in users too). You can choose a species, genes and markings apply. It's very unpolished.

By winning races, you will earn a new currency called sea dollars. You can spend this currency to unlock a random novelty duck (no duplicates). These are new decor items that count to 100%
